Guidance for Maintenance Task Identification and Analysis: Organizational and Intermediate Maintenance.
Abstract
This report was to develop guidance for Air Force, other DoD agencies, and industry in the use of specifications contained in AFHRL-TR-79-50 to fulfill the requirements for maintenance task identification and analysis (MTI and A). Several new types of technical data, such as job guide manuals (JGMs) and logic tree troubleshooting aids (LTTAs), have been adopted for use by the Air Force. The development of accurate and effective JGMs and LTTAs requires that a thorough MTI&A be accomplished to prepare the data base from which JGMs and LTTAs are developed. At present the only suitable data specification available to establish JGMs and LTTAs is AFHRL-TR-79-50. The guidance developed here is to assist in the application of that specification. This report is to be used as a handbook. An overview of MTI&A processes is presented followed by a listing of fundamental requirements to be performed prior to the actual start of MTI&A. Once the analyst has become knowledgeable of the preliminary requirement of MTI&A the handbook provides the directions on how to perform MTI&A. It includes definitions, procedures, planning data, staffing criteria, checklists, suggested forms, and guidelines for review, evaluation, and quality audit of MTI&A products. Guidance is provided for conducting MTI&A for programs with Logistics Support Analysis data available and for programs which do not have this data. The guidance provided by the specification and its guide book are suitable for the procurement of MTI&A for both organizational and intermediate levels of maintenance. (Author)
